2017-10-15 75 views
0

第一張海報在這裏。 我剛剛用webpack創建了一個新的Rails項目(rails new myapp --webpack)。它帶有PostCSS,我想爲其添加LostGrid。我從失落的運行下面,從安裝instructions使用webpack將LostGrid添加到Ruby on Rails

npm install --save lost 

這增加輸給package.json。該指令,則說以下內容添加到您的WebPack配置,假設你已經postcss裝載機安裝配置&(我的理解是自動安裝在創建項目時):

postcss: [ 
    require('lost') 
] 

但我不明白的地方該文件是。我認爲我需要將我的PostCSS內容添加到根中的.postcssrc.yml。我這樣做,但我仍然沒有得到它的工作。

我對webpack很少有經驗,並懷疑我的方法是完全有缺陷的。我很高興在Rails中使用PostCSS,並希望能夠幫助您使LostGrid在這裏工作。謝謝!

回答

0

發現你的問題後,我碰到了同樣的問題。幸運的是它非常簡單!

當您運行webpacker:install時,它會在項目的根文件夾中安裝名爲.postcssrc.yml的文件。這是你添加PostCSS插件的地方。我現在看起來像這樣:

plugins: 
     lost: {} 
     postcss-smart-import: {} 
     postcss-cssnext: {} 
     autoprefixer: {} 

我不確定訂單是否重要。仍在研究。

查看Webpacker issue #283這是基本上相同的問題,但沒有提供示例。

+0

是的,順序很重要:) – jhpratt

相關問題